Understanding the DOGE-RUB Exchange Rate

The conversion rate between Dogecoin and the Russian Ruble is a dynamic figure, influenced by a complex interplay of global crypto sentiment, fiat currency strength, and regional economic factors. Bybit, a major cryptocurrency exchange, provides this conversion tool to help users quickly assess the value of their DOGE holdings in rubles.

For Russian-speaking traders and those dealing with RUB-based transactions, the DOGE-RUB pair is particularly relevant. It allows for direct valuation without the need for an intermediate conversion through the US dollar, reducing potential friction and transaction costs. The rate is updated continuously, reflecting the volatile nature of both the cryptocurrency and traditional forex markets.
